Patna: In Bihar CM Nitish Kumar's home district Nalanda, the police who had gone to nab the liquor mafia were attacked by villagers. In this attack, 10 police personnel, including the constable, were seriously injured. The police vehicle was also damaged. According to information, the police had received information about liquor being made in Manikpur village under Parwalpur police station of Nalanda district in Bihar.

Following this information, about two dozen policemen led by the SHO rushed to the village to conduct a raid. Police recovered 10 litres of country liquor from the spot, and arrested Mantu Yadav for allegedly carrying out illegal liquor business. The police were arresting Mantu, in the meantime, hundreds of women, men and youths from the village reached there to rescue Mantu.

The villagers attacked the police with bricks, stones and sticks. In this attack, 10 policemen, including SHO Raman Prakash Vashisht, were injured. The condition of Santosh Kumar and Baijnath Ram is said to be critical, while sub-inspectors CK Singh, ASI Bijender Das, Arvind Singh, Gore Lal Yadav, Umesh Prasad, Vishal Kumar, Vijay Yadav are also injured. Who are being treated at the health centre, Parwalpur.
